To the executive team and heads of department: following the disruption at our sole resin supplier, Marbeck Polymers, we have begun a structured second-source search. Three candidates in the Ostlund region passed initial quality screening; sample runs start next month. Procurement will circulate a comparison matrix covering cost, lead time, and certification status. Please review the confidential context that follows before commenting.

board note of bawep-tajef: Queniusek Systems plans to raise the Quenvan list price by 53.1 percent in March. The pricing group signed off on a budget of $176.4 million for Project Drueth. The renewal with Casionix Partners closes at $142.5 million a year, 8.3 percent below the last contract. Project Fraax slips by six weeks because of the tooling delay.

For sales leads. Headline: the Tarnwell industrial coatings unit is being divested. Carrying value written down 12% last quarter; buyer diligence closes end of month. Revenue attributed to Tarnwell drops out of your targets from Q2 — adjusted quotas to follow. Pipeline deals involving Tarnwell products: close what you can, escalate anything beyond 90 days. No customer communications until the announcement. Commission treatment for in-flight deals is protected. The reasoning behind the sale is summarised below.

confidential, kagep-kahof: Druokax Systems plans to lower the Ulaath list price by 53 percent in March.

Hi support crew,

Quick heads-up: Thursday's disaster-recovery drill at Pennover will focus on the spreadsheet export service, since memory usage spikes whenever someone exports the full ledger. We'll simulate an OOM crash and fail over to the Larkmoor replica. If the console locks you out mid-drill, use the recovery passphrase, which is included just below.

vault phrase of bagaf-kajeg = jorath-feniel-briir-siliel-ralix

Handover note — Crumbwheel order cutoffs.

Welcome aboard. The bakery cutoff rule in Crumbwheel closes same-day orders at 14:00 local to each storefront, not UTC — this has bitten us twice. Holiday overrides live in the calendar service and take precedence silently, so always check there first when a cutoff looks wrong. To unlock the calendar service's admin console after a restart, enter the recovery passphrase below.

vault phrase of bagap-bahaf = silion-pelox-sorox-casdor-quenwyn-fraax-eliox-praael-kelion-quenvan-kasox-rusael-norius-belvan